The Language of Light: Mastering Creativity & Control An Advanced Lighting Workshop for Professional Photographers Light is more than exposure—it is language. It communicates emotion, defines mood, and shapes how a viewer experiences an image. The Language of Light: Mastering Creativity & Control is a refined, hands-on lighting workshop designed for professional photographers who want to move beyond recipes and presets and gain true command over light. This class focuses on understanding why light behaves the way it does, how to shape it with intention, and how to make lighting decisions that support storytelling, brand consistency, and higher-end work. Through live demonstrations, real-world scenarios, and guided shooting, attendees will learn to analyze light quickly, solve complex lighting challenges with confidence, and create images that feel deliberate rather than accidental. Emphasis is placed on direction, quality, contrast, and control, rather than gear dependency—allowing photographers to adapt seamlessly in studio or on location. This workshop is ideal for photographers who already understand lighting fundamentals and are ready to refine their creative voice, improve efficiency, and produce work that stands apart in a competitive market. What attendees will gain: A deeper understanding of how light influences emotion and narrative Practical strategies for controlling light in unpredictable environments The ability to build lighting intentionally rather than relying on formulas A more consistent, recognizable visual style Increased confidence when lighting higher-end clients and editorial work This class is not about learning more setups—it is about learning to think in light.

Javon Longieliere, M.Photog., M.Wed.Photog., Cr.Photog., CPP, is an award-winning professional photographer, educator, and lighting specialist with over two decades of experience creating refined, story-driven imagery for editorial, portrait, and wedding clients. He holds multiple professional degrees through Professional Photographers of America, including Master Photographer, Master Wedding Photographer, and Photographic Craftsman, and is a Certified Professional Photographer (CPP)—distinctions that reflect both technical mastery and a sustained commitment to photographic excellence and education. In 2025, Javon was selected to represent Team USA at the World Photographic Cup, placing him among an elite group of photographers competing on the global stage. A past President and long-serving board member of the Georgia Professional Photographers Association, Javon has judged print competitions, mentored photographers at all stages of their careers, and taught advanced lighting concepts to working professionals nationwide. Javon’s teaching philosophy emphasizes understanding the behavior, intent, and control of light, rather than relying on formulas or gear dependency. Through his workshop, The Language of Light: Mastering Creativity & Control, he challenges photographers to think critically, work efficiently in real-world conditions, and create imagery with clarity, confidence, and purpose.
